Maqsood
Desired, Intended, Wished For
Pronunciation: /mɑːksuːd/ (/mɑːksuːd/)
What does Maqsood mean?
What is meant, intended, or desired, which is a goal or purpose to be achieved

Spiritual & cultural context
A name that signifies one's purpose and destiny in life, reflecting the deep inner longing and aspiration for personal growth and fulfillment
The name Maqsood carries a strong cultural significance with the implication of achievement and realization of dreams. In the context of Muslim culture, this name is often given to children as a reminder of the importance of setting and achieving goals, reflecting the Islamic value of striving towards success in both worldly and spiritual endeavors.
